PUT solicitação para fazer upload de um arquivo que não está funcionando no Flask

Estou trabalhando em um aplicativo Web usando o Flask. Supõe-se que uma das visualizações aceite arquivos enviados por meio de solicitações PUT, mas só posso receber solicitações POST com$ curl -F upload=@filename URL para funcionar corretamente. Com solicitações PUT como$ curl --upload-file filenname URL arequest.files ImmutableMultiDict está vazio. Estou faltando alguma coisa no Flask ou talvez usando o curl?

questionAnswers(2)

yourAnswerToTheQuestion